Why Garfield's Ground Conditions Matter
Garfield sits east of the Balcones Escarpment in the Blackland Prairie belt, where deep expansive clay soils dominate. These clays swell dramatically when wet and shrink during dry spells, putting constant stress on slab foundations and creating cracks that allow moisture and humidity into wall cavities and crawlspaces.

How does Blackland Prairie clay affect mold risk in Garfield?
The Blackland Prairie clay under Garfield is some of the most expansive soil in Texas. After a heavy rain it can swell several inches; in summer drought it shrinks back, pulling away from foundations. That seasonal motion cracks slabs, breaks underground plumbing, and opens hairline gaps at slab edges where humid air and capillary moisture wick into the home. Many Garfield mold problems trace back to a slab crack the homeowner never knew existed, feeding moisture into baseboards, flooring, and lower wall cavities for years. Our inspectors evaluate slab moisture, check for foundation movement, and pinpoint where that hidden water is feeding any mold growth.
How does Garfield's flash-flood risk influence mold testing?
Garfield sits inside what meteorologists call 'Flash Flood Alley' — the I-35 corridor from the Hill Country through Austin to San Antonio where intense storms can dump 4-8 inches of rain in just a few hours. Even properties that aren't in a designated floodplain can take on water from overwhelmed street drainage, backed-up storm drains, or saturated soil pushing against foundations. After every major rain event we see a wave of Garfield homes with hidden moisture behind walls, in subfloors, and in lower cabinets — often weeks before any visible staining appears. If your home has experienced any standing water, even briefly, professional moisture mapping and air sampling is the only reliable way to know whether mold has begun growing.
